Why Monitoring Carbon Intensity Matters

Understanding daily carbon intensity levels can help reduce your household’s or business’s carbon footprint. When demand is high, the grid often turns to fossil fuel-based generation methods, increasing CO₂ emissions. By planning activities like running washing machines, dishwashers, or charging electric vehicles during lower-intensity periods, you contribute to a more sustainable energy system.
